Embodiment Construction

[0017] The specific embodiment of the present invention will be further described below in conjunction with accompanying drawing:

[0018] See figure 1 , is a structural schematic diagram of an embodiment of the dry automatic sorting system for talc raw ore of the present invention, including a feeding hopper 13, a hoist 16, a dry arc elastic separator 17 and a dust collector 19, and the feeding hopper 13 is sequentially connected with the adjusting gate 14, reciprocating The car 15, hoist 16, and dry-type arc-shaped elastic separator 17 are connected by technology. The dry-type arc-shaped elastic separator 17 is provided with a dust extraction pipe 18 connected to the dust collector 19 and the fan 21. Abstract

The invention relates to a dry-type automatic sorting system for a crude talc ore. The system is characterized in that a material-feeding hopper is sequentially and technically connected with a regulating gate, a reciprocating vehicle, a hoisting machine and a dry-type arc-shaped elasticity sorting machine; the dry-type arc-shaped elasticity sorting machine is provided with a dust extracting pipeand connected with a dust remover and a draught fan; three outlets are arranged below the dry-type arc-shaped elasticity sorting machine; the outlet I, the outlet II and the outlet III are correspondingly connected with a fine-grain raw material warehouse, a medium-grain raw material warehouse and a coarse-grain raw material warehouse respectively through a fine-grain conveyer, a medium-grain conveyer and a coarse-grain conveyer; and the dry-type arc-shaped elasticity sorting machine comprises an enclosed shell, a supporting seat, an elastic rubber block and an arc-shaped bottom board. Compared with the prior art, the system provided by the invention has the following beneficial effects that: 1, the system can be directly used for the crude talc ore dry sorting and in particular to the sorting of the talc below 25 mm, and the sorting rate over 95 percent is achieved; 2, the sorting process is completely closed so that no water and dust pollution are generated; and 3, a phenomenon of blocking a filter screen does not appear because an elastic nylon filter screen is used.

Description

technical field [0001] The invention relates to the field of talc raw ore separation, in particular to a dry type automatic separation system for talc raw ore. Background technique [0002] At present, the sorting of domestic talc raw ore mainly relies on the following two methods. One is to use manual selection of raw ore. The disadvantages are: it increases the labor intensity of workers, the work efficiency is too low, the production cost is too high, and the size of the raw ore is too small. Particle selection is difficult; the second is to sort the powder by flotation. The area is large, the pollution caused by sewage and tailings is relatively serious, the discharge is not easy to deal with, the utilization rate of mineral resources is low, and water resources are wasted.
